Installation and connection
69
External condensed water out‐
let
Notes
When drying is in progress, con‐
densed
water is pumped into the con‐
densed water container through the
drain hose which is located at the
back of the dryer.
The condensed water can also be
drained away via the drain hose so that
the condensed water container does
not have to be emptied.
Drain hose length: 1.60 m
Maximu
m delivery head: 1.50 m
Maximum drain hose length: 4.00 m
The following optional accessories
ar
e available:
an extension hose,
a non-return valve kit for connection
t
o an external water outlet. The kit in‐
cludes an extension hose.
Installation conditions requiring a
non
-return valve
There is a risk of back-flow into
the dryer if a non-return valve is not
fitted.
Back-flow could damage the dryer
and also
the room in which it is loca‐
ted.
Certain installation conditions, such
as those
described below, require
the fitting of a non-return valve.
Maximum delivery head with non-return
valve fitted: 1.00 m
Installation conditions requiring the fit‐
ting of a non-return valve:
Drainage into a sink or floor gully
wher
e the end of the hose is im‐
mersed in water.
Connection to a sink drain outlet.
Connection to a drainage system al‐
r
eady in use by another appliance,
e.g. a dishwasher or washing ma‐
chine.
The non-
return valve has to be
fitted with the arrow pointing in the
direction of flow.
Otherwise water will not drain out of
the appliance.
